linux压缩包怎么用命令

fiy 其他 37

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    使用命令操作Linux压缩包的过程如下:

    1. 解压缩文件:使用 tar 命令解压缩.tar 文件;
    “`
    tar -xvf filename.tar
    “`
    其中,-x 表示解压缩,-v 表示显示详细信息,-f 表示指定需要解压缩的文件。

    2. 打包文件:使用 tar 命令打包文件为.tar 文件;
    “`
    tar -cvf filename.tar file1 file2 file3 …
    “`
    其中,-c 表示打包,-v 表示显示详细信息,-f 表示指定打包后的文件名。

    3. 压缩文件:使用 gzip、bzip2 或 xz 命令压缩.tar 文件;
    – 使用 gzip 压缩文件:
    “`
    gzip filename.tar
    “`
    压缩后将生成.tar.gz 文件。
    – 使用 bzip2 压缩文件:
    “`
    bzip2 filename.tar
    “`
    压缩后将生成.tar.bz2 文件。
    – 使用 xz 压缩文件:
    “`
    xz filename.tar
    “`
    压缩后将生成.tar.xz 文件。

    4. 解压缩压缩文件:使用 gzip、bzip2 或 xz 命令解压缩.tar.gz、.tar.bz2 或.tar.xz 文件;
    – 使用 gzip 解压缩文件:
    “`
    gzip -d filename.tar.gz
    “`
    解压缩后将生成.tar 文件。
    – 使用 bzip2 解压缩文件:
    “`
    bzip2 -d filename.tar.bz2
    “`
    解压缩后将生成.tar 文件。
    – 使用 xz 解压缩文件:
    “`
    xz -d filename.tar.xz
    “`
    解压缩后将生成.tar 文件。

    5. 查看压缩文件内容:使用 tar 命令查看压缩文件内容;
    “`
    tar -tvf filename.tar
    “`
    其中,-t 表示查看内容,-v 表示显示详细信息,-f 表示指定需要查看的文件。

    以上就是使用命令操作Linux压缩包的基本方法。根据实际需求和使用场景,可以选择合适的命令和选项进行操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用命令行在Linux中解压和压缩文件或文件夹非常常见。下面是一些常用的命令:

    1. 解压缩:
    – tar命令:解压.tar文件
    “`
    tar -xf file.tar
    “`

    – tar.gz或tgz命令:解压.tar.gz或.tgz文件
    “`
    tar -xzf file.tar.gz
    “`

    – tar.bz2命令:解压.tar.bz2文件
    “`
    tar -xjf file.tar.bz2
    “`

    – zip命令:解压.zip文件
    “`
    unzip file.zip
    “`

    2. 压缩:
    – tar命令:压缩为.tar文件
    “`
    tar -cf archive.tar file1 file2
    “`

    – tar.gz或tgz命令:压缩为.tar.gz或.tgz文件
    “`
    tar -czf archive.tar.gz file1 file2
    “`

    – tar.bz2命令:压缩为.tar.bz2文件
    “`
    tar -cjf archive.tar.bz2 file1 file2
    “`

    – zip命令:压缩为.zip文件
    “`
    zip archive.zip file1 file2
    “`

    3. 查看压缩包内容:
    – tar命令:查看.tar文件内容
    “`
    tar -tf file.tar
    “`

    – tar.gz或tgz命令:查看.tar.gz或.tgz文件内容
    “`
    tar -tzf file.tar.gz
    “`

    – tar.bz2命令:查看.tar.bz2文件内容
    “`
    tar -tjf file.tar.bz2
    “`

    – zip命令:查看.zip文件内容
    “`
    unzip -l file.zip
    “`

    4. 递归压缩文件夹:
    – tar命令:压缩文件夹为.tar文件
    “`
    tar -cf archive.tar folder
    “`

    – tar.gz或tgz命令:压缩文件夹为.tar.gz或.tgz文件
    “`
    tar -czf archive.tar.gz folder
    “`

    – tar.bz2命令:压缩文件夹为.tar.bz2文件
    “`
    tar -cjf archive.tar.bz2 folder
    “`

    – zip命令:压缩文件夹为.zip文件
    “`
    zip -r archive.zip folder
    “`

    5. 压缩多个文件或文件夹:
    – tar命令:压缩多个文件或文件夹为.tar文件
    “`
    tar -cf archive.tar file1 file2 folder
    “`

    – tar.gz或tgz命令:压缩多个文件或文件夹为.tar.gz或.tgz文件
    “`
    tar -czf archive.tar.gz file1 file2 folder
    “`

    – tar.bz2命令:压缩多个文件或文件夹为.tar.bz2文件
    “`
    tar -cjf archive.tar.bz2 file1 file2 folder
    “`

    – zip命令:压缩多个文件或文件夹为.zip文件
    “`
    zip archive.zip file1 file2 folder
    “`

    这些命令涵盖了在Linux中使用命令行进行解压和压缩的基本操作,通过使用这些命令可以方便地处理压缩文件和文件夹。可以根据实际需要选择合适的命令来进行解压和压缩操作,也可以结合其他命令和选项来满足更复杂的需求。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,我们可以使用命令行来进行压缩和解压缩操作。常见的压缩格式包括.tar,.gz,.zip等。下面是一些常用的命令以及操作流程。

    1. 压缩文件或目录到.tar格式

    使用tar命令可以将文件或目录压缩成.tar格式的压缩包。

    “`shell
    tar -cvf archive.tar file1 file2 directory1
    “`

    – -c:创建一个新的tar文件
    – -v:显示详细信息
    – -f:指定压缩后的文件名

    2. 压缩文件或目录到.tar.gz格式

    使用tar命令结合gzip命令可以将文件或目录压缩成.tar.gz格式的压缩包。

    “`shell
    tar -czvf archive.tar.gz file1 file2 directory1
    “`

    – -z:使用gzip压缩
    – -c:创建一个新的tar文件
    – -v:显示详细信息
    – -f:指定压缩后的文件名

    3. 压缩文件或目录到.zip格式

    使用zip命令可以将文件或目录压缩成.zip格式的压缩包。

    “`shell
    zip -r archive.zip file1 file2 directory1
    “`

    – -r:递归压缩目录下的所有文件和子目录

    4. 解压.tar文件

    解压一个.tar文件非常简单。

    “`shell
    tar -xvf archive.tar
    “`

    – -x:解压文件
    – -v:显示详细信息
    – -f:指定要解压的文件名

    5. 解压.tar.gz文件

    解压一个.tar.gz文件需要先解压gzip压缩,再解压tar文件。

    “`shell
    tar -xzvf archive.tar.gz
    “`

    – -x:解压文件
    – -z:使用gzip解压
    – -v:显示详细信息
    – -f:指定要解压的文件名

    6. 解压.zip文件

    解压一个.zip文件非常简单。

    “`shell
    unzip archive.zip
    “`

    以上是常见的压缩和解压缩命令和操作流程。在Linux系统中,还有其他一些压缩格式和对应的命令,具体可以查看相关文档或使用命令帮助来了解更多信息。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部